Riesling, the all-rounder

When you think of German Riesling, perhaps you picture sickly-sweet one-litre cartons of Liebfraumilch, or enamel-stripping, face-puckering wines. But it can do so much more. From surprisingly fruity wines from the Moselle to full-bodied and powerful wines from the Rheingau. Would you like a dessert wine with a fresh acidity, or perhaps a wonderfully elegant sparkling wine? The Riesling grape simply offers it all.
